Transaction 8eae210bfd61b68c090e3669c8d6f717fbb6fcb49896234091f880096e6750b5

2 Input
1 Outputs
  • 8eae210bfd61b68c090e3669c8d6f717fbb6fcb49896234091f880096e6750b5:0
  • value  1078779
    address  1FLoe9QaaLnRrS3Wj5Xbn3xfzeHY3Dw4S1